(nothing, really: comment cleanup, indent, beautification, translation...)

This commit is contained in:
mtarini 2013-06-04 11:55:33 +00:00
parent 6b7ca162ce
commit 2c3d20ca40
1 changed files with 314 additions and 318 deletions

View File

@ -65,10 +65,8 @@ typedef typename OpenMeshType::VertexIterator VertexIterator;
typedef typename OpenMeshType::FaceIterator FaceIterator; typedef typename OpenMeshType::FaceIterator FaceIterator;
typedef typename OpenMeshType::EdgeIterator EdgeIterator; typedef typename OpenMeshType::EdgeIterator EdgeIterator;
//template <class T> int PlyType () { assert(0); return 0;}
#define MAX_USER_DATA 256 #define MAX_USER_DATA 256
// Struttura ausiliaria per la lettura del file ply // Auxiliary structure for reading ply files
struct LoadPly_FaceAux struct LoadPly_FaceAux
{ {
unsigned char size; unsigned char size;
@ -109,7 +107,7 @@ struct LoadPly_RangeGridAux {
}; };
// Struttura ausiliaria per la lettura del file ply // Auxiliary structure to load vertex data
template<class S> template<class S>
struct LoadPly_VertAux struct LoadPly_VertAux
{ {
@ -126,7 +124,7 @@ struct LoadPly_VertAux
float u,v,w; float u,v,w;
}; };
// Struttura ausiliaria caricamento camera // Auxiliary structure to load the camera
struct LoadPly_Camera struct LoadPly_Camera
{ {
float view_px; float view_px;
@ -414,7 +412,7 @@ static int Open( OpenMeshType &m, const char * filename, PlyInfo &pi )
if(found) pi.mask |= Mask::IOM_CAMERA; if(found) pi.mask |= Mask::IOM_CAMERA;
} }
// Descrittori dati standard (vertex coord e faces) // Standard data desciptors (vertex coord and faces)
if( pf.AddToRead(VertDesc(0))==-1 && pf.AddToRead(VertDesc(22)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; } if( pf.AddToRead(VertDesc(0))==-1 && pf.AddToRead(VertDesc(22)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; }
if( pf.AddToRead(VertDesc(1))==-1 && pf.AddToRead(VertDesc(23)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; } if( pf.AddToRead(VertDesc(1))==-1 && pf.AddToRead(VertDesc(23)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; }
if( pf.AddToRead(VertDesc(2))==-1 && pf.AddToRead(VertDesc(24)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; } if( pf.AddToRead(VertDesc(2))==-1 && pf.AddToRead(VertDesc(24)) ) { pi.status = PlyInfo::E_NO_VERTEX; return pi.status; }
@ -433,7 +431,7 @@ static int Open( OpenMeshType &m, const char * filename, PlyInfo &pi )
} }
} }
// Descrittori facoltativi dei flags // Optional flag descriptors
if(pf.AddToRead(EdgeDesc(0) )!= -1 && pf.AddToRead(EdgeDesc(1)) != -1 ) if(pf.AddToRead(EdgeDesc(0) )!= -1 && pf.AddToRead(EdgeDesc(1)) != -1 )
pi.mask |= Mask::IOM_EDGEINDEX; pi.mask |= Mask::IOM_EDGEINDEX;
@ -537,7 +535,7 @@ static int Open( OpenMeshType &m, const char * filename, PlyInfo &pi )
} }
} }
// Descrittori definiti dall'utente, // User defined descriptors
std::vector<PropDescriptor> VPV(pi.vdn); // property descriptor relative al tipo LoadPly_VertexAux std::vector<PropDescriptor> VPV(pi.vdn); // property descriptor relative al tipo LoadPly_VertexAux
std::vector<PropDescriptor> FPV(pi.fdn); // property descriptor relative al tipo LoadPly_FaceAux std::vector<PropDescriptor> FPV(pi.fdn); // property descriptor relative al tipo LoadPly_FaceAux
if(pi.vdn>0){ if(pi.vdn>0){
@ -1117,19 +1115,19 @@ static bool LoadMask(const char * filename, int &mask, PlyInfo &pi)
if( pf.AddToRead(VertDesc(11))!=-1 ) mask |= Mask::IOM_VERTQUALITY; if( pf.AddToRead(VertDesc(11))!=-1 ) mask |= Mask::IOM_VERTQUALITY;
if( pf.AddToRead(VertDesc(15))!=-1 ) mask |= Mask::IOM_VERTRADIUS; if( pf.AddToRead(VertDesc(15))!=-1 ) mask |= Mask::IOM_VERTRADIUS;
if( pf.AddToRead(VertDesc(28))!=-1 ) mask |= Mask::IOM_VERTRADIUS; if( pf.AddToRead(VertDesc(28))!=-1 ) mask |= Mask::IOM_VERTRADIUS;
if( ( pf.AddToRead(VertDesc( 5))!=-1 ) && if( pf.AddToRead(VertDesc( 5))!=-1 &&
( pf.AddToRead(VertDesc( 6))!=-1 ) && pf.AddToRead(VertDesc( 6))!=-1 &&
( pf.AddToRead(VertDesc( 7))!=-1 ) ) mask |= Mask::IOM_VERTCOLOR; pf.AddToRead(VertDesc( 7))!=-1 ) mask |= Mask::IOM_VERTCOLOR;
if( ( pf.AddToRead(VertDesc( 8))!=-1 ) && if( pf.AddToRead(VertDesc( 8))!=-1 &&
( pf.AddToRead(VertDesc( 9))!=-1 ) && pf.AddToRead(VertDesc( 9))!=-1 &&
( pf.AddToRead(VertDesc(10))!=-1 ) ) mask |= Mask::IOM_VERTCOLOR; pf.AddToRead(VertDesc(10))!=-1 ) mask |= Mask::IOM_VERTCOLOR;
if( pf.AddToRead(VertDesc(19))!=-1 ) mask |= Mask::IOM_VERTCOLOR; if( pf.AddToRead(VertDesc(19))!=-1 ) mask |= Mask::IOM_VERTCOLOR;
if(( pf.AddToRead(VertDesc(20))!=-1 ) && (pf.AddToRead(VertDesc(21))!=-1)) if( pf.AddToRead(VertDesc(20))!=-1 &&
mask |= Mask::IOM_VERTTEXCOORD; pf.AddToRead(VertDesc(21))!=-1) mask |= Mask::IOM_VERTTEXCOORD;
if(( pf.AddToRead(VertDesc(16))!=-1 ) && (pf.AddToRead(VertDesc(17))!=-1)) if( pf.AddToRead(VertDesc(16))!=-1 &&
mask |= Mask::IOM_VERTTEXCOORD; pf.AddToRead(VertDesc(17))!=-1) mask |= Mask::IOM_VERTTEXCOORD;
if( pf.AddToRead(FaceDesc(0))!=-1 ) mask |= Mask::IOM_FACEINDEX; if( pf.AddToRead(FaceDesc(0))!=-1 ) mask |= Mask::IOM_FACEINDEX;
if( pf.AddToRead(FaceDesc(1))!=-1 ) mask |= Mask::IOM_FACEFLAGS; if( pf.AddToRead(FaceDesc(1))!=-1 ) mask |= Mask::IOM_FACEFLAGS;
@ -1138,10 +1136,9 @@ static bool LoadMask(const char * filename, int &mask, PlyInfo &pi)
if( pf.AddToRead(FaceDesc(3))!=-1 ) mask |= Mask::IOM_WEDGTEXCOORD; if( pf.AddToRead(FaceDesc(3))!=-1 ) mask |= Mask::IOM_WEDGTEXCOORD;
if( pf.AddToRead(FaceDesc(5))!=-1 ) mask |= Mask::IOM_WEDGTEXMULTI; if( pf.AddToRead(FaceDesc(5))!=-1 ) mask |= Mask::IOM_WEDGTEXMULTI;
if( pf.AddToRead(FaceDesc(4))!=-1 ) mask |= Mask::IOM_WEDGCOLOR; if( pf.AddToRead(FaceDesc(4))!=-1 ) mask |= Mask::IOM_WEDGCOLOR;
if( ( pf.AddToRead(FaceDesc(6))!=-1 ) && if( pf.AddToRead(FaceDesc(6))!=-1 &&
( pf.AddToRead(FaceDesc(7))!=-1 ) && pf.AddToRead(FaceDesc(7))!=-1 &&
( pf.AddToRead(FaceDesc(8))!=-1 ) ) mask |= Mask::IOM_FACECOLOR; pf.AddToRead(FaceDesc(8))!=-1 ) mask |= Mask::IOM_FACECOLOR;
return true; return true;
} }
@ -1150,7 +1147,6 @@ static bool LoadMask(const char * filename, int &mask, PlyInfo &pi)
}; // end class }; // end class
} // end namespace tri } // end namespace tri
} // end namespace io } // end namespace io
} // end namespace vcg } // end namespace vcg